Abstract

The invention discloses a big data accurate marketing system with privacy protection, equipment and a processing device. The method comprises the steps that an original data server replaces user identification marks in original data with encrypted identification mark information and sends the encrypted identification mark information to a big data processing server, the big data processing server analyzes and processes data, portrait analysis of each user is completed, corresponding labels are marked on the users, the encrypted identification marks and label information of the users are sent to a big data label server, and the big data label server stores the encrypted identification marks of the users and the label information corresponding to the users into a database to wait for calling. The method protects the privacy of the users in the big data application process, and enables marketing clients to actively screen target users in the accurate marketing process of big data.

Background
Big data is more and more widely applied, and accurate marketing based on big data is an important field of big data application. The method is characterized in that analysis processing of massive user big data cannot be conducted based on accurate marketing of the big data, the process of the analysis processing is called user portrait, and a series of labels are marked on a user portrait result to identify the gender, age, consumption capability, interests and hobbies of the user. The precise marketing process is to filter the target users based on the tags and then to send the specified content to the target users in an appropriate manner.
The problem that current accurate marketing mode based on big data exists:
(1) marketing customers lack the ability to actively screen users: when a customer with marketing requirements provides marketing requirements for the delivery platform, the customer can only provide simple delivery quantity and delivery time periods, can not actively screen target users according to the needs of the customer, can not actively adjust the screening conditions of the target users according to the delivery effects of the customer, and is not beneficial to the rapid optimization iteration of marketing activities.
(2) The lack of an effective protection mechanism for user privacy information in big data processing and application processes: in the process of big data application, a lot of original data contain privacy information such as user identity marks, and in the process of big data analysis processing, labeling and application of the original data, multi-party cooperation is often needed, an effective sensitive data protection mechanism is lacked, which means that important privacy information of users is easily revealed, and a great safety risk exists.
Therefore, there is a need for a method that can not only fully exert the ability of big data, but also effectively protect the privacy of users, so that the data can be reasonably utilized under the condition that the privacy of users is well protected, and the demander of data has the ability of actively screening required data, thereby fully exerting the value of big data.

Detailed Description
The following examples are intended to illustrate the invention but are not intended to limit the scope of the invention.
As shown in fig. 1, a big data precision marketing system with privacy protection includes an original data server 1, an identity encryption and decryption server 2, a big data processing server 3, a big data tag server 4, a marketing management server 5, a marketing delivery server 6, a user demand collection client 7, and a user demand management server 8;
the original data server 1 is used for storing original data containing plaintext user identification information from a service system, the original data server 1 submits the original data to the big data processing server 3 and sends an encrypted identification information acquisition request to the identification encryption and decryption server 2, the identification encryption server returns encrypted identification information after receiving the request, and the original data server 1 replaces the user identification in the original data with the encrypted identification information and sends the encrypted identification information to the big data processing server 3;
the big data processing server 3 is used for analyzing and processing data to finish portrait analysis of each user and sending the encrypted identity identification and the label information of the user to the big data label server 4;
the big data label server 4 stores the encrypted identity of the user and the label information corresponding to the user into a database to wait for calling;
the user demand collection client 7 is used for providing a marketing demand input interface for a user, communicating with the user demand management server 8, sending demand data submitted by the user to the user demand management server 8, and obtaining a target user screening result and a task delivery result from the user demand management server 8 by the user demand collection client 7;
the user requirement management server 8 is used for receiving and storing the user requirement sent by the user requirement acquisition client 7 and submitting the requirement to the marketing management server 5;
the marketing management server 5 is used for receiving and managing marketing demands sent by the user demand management server 8, the marketing management server 5 submits data extraction demands to the big data tag server 4 according to launching tasks, and the marketing management server 5 sends launching information to the marketing launching server 6 after obtaining user data returned by the big data tag server 4;
the marketing putting server 6 is used for sending or displaying information to the user; the big data label server 4 is used for analyzing according to the user behavior data, labeling the user from a plurality of dimensions according to the analysis result, and identifying the characteristics of the user, and the big data label server 4 screens out the target user according with the requirement of data screening submitted by the marketing management server 5.
In an embodiment of the big data accurate marketing system with privacy protection, the original service data contained in the original data server 1 is one or more items of plaintext identification information, the plaintext identification information includes resident identification card information, a biological feature identification, a mobile phone number, an IMEI, and an MAC address, and the identification encryption/decryption server 2 is configured to be responsible for uniformly managing the identification of the user, and return encrypted identification information of a specified type as needed. The user identification information in the data of the original data server 1 can be a resident identification card, a biological characteristic identification (fingerprint, eye print, face print), a mobile phone number, an IMEI (international mobile equipment identity), and an MAC (media access control) address. The identity card or the biological characteristic identity is a unique permanent identity, and the mobile phone number, the IMEI and the MAC address are non-permanent non-unique identity information.
In an embodiment of the big data precision marketing system with privacy protection, the original data server 1 communicates with the id encryption/decryption server 2, the original data server 1 sends a user id encryption request to the id encryption/decryption server 2, the id encryption/decryption server 2 returns encrypted user id information to the original data server 1, and the user id encryption request sent by the original data server 1 to the id encryption/decryption server 2 at least includes:
plaintext identification information;
a plaintext identity type;
the requested encrypted user identification information;
the requested encrypted user identity type;
the identity encryption and decryption server 2 feeds back the encrypted user identity information to the original data server 1 after receiving the user identity encryption request, and the information returned by the identity encryption and decryption server 2 at least comprises:
encrypting user identification information;
encrypting the user identity type;
a plaintext identity type;
and (4) plaintext identification information.
The original data server 1 sends an identity encryption request to the identity encryption and decryption server 2, and the requests can be sent in batches or in a single way; each identity comprises identity information and a corresponding identity type.
In a request sent by an original data server 1 to an identity encryption and decryption server 2, if the request contains more than one identity, the identity encryption and decryption server 2 judges whether the identity has a unique identifier, if the identity has the unique identifier, the unique identifier is taken as a standard, the unique identifier is compared with existing data in an identity encryption and decryption server 2 library, the unique identifier is associated with existing data to be updated in the identity encryption and decryption server 2 library, and then user data is updated or added; if the request sent by the original data server 1 does not contain the unique permanent identifier, and the corresponding relation of the data is inconsistent with the existing data in the identity encryption and decryption server 2 library, the data of the identity encryption and decryption server 2 is not updated, and only the information is kept in a table to be updated; when the data with the unique identification and the data with the non-unique identification simultaneously appear, the related information is updated.
The id encryption and decryption server 2 may use MD5, SHA128, SHA256 or other one-way encryption algorithm for the id. When MD5 encrypts, the encryption effect is enhanced by adding salt.
In order to reduce the encryption acquisition request of the original data server 1 to the identity encryption and decryption server 2, when the original data server 1 receives the encrypted identity information returned by the identity encryption and decryption server 2, a copy of the encrypted identity information can be locally reserved, the life cycle of the copy is set, in the life cycle of the copy, when the original data server 1 needs to acquire the encrypted identity, the local copy can be inquired first, and if the local copy has the corresponding encrypted identity information, the encrypted identity information is directly acquired from the local; and if the local copy does not have the corresponding encrypted identification information, sending a request to the identification encryption and decryption server 2 for obtaining.
Referring to fig. 2, fig. 2 is a schematic flow chart of communication between an original data server 1 and an identity encryption/decryption server 2 in the present application example, where the method is an application and acquisition process of an encrypted identity, and completes hiding of key information of a user by encrypting a plaintext identity, so as to protect privacy of the user. The method includes, but is not limited to, the steps of:
f201, the id encryption/decryption server 2 receives an encrypted id acquisition request sent by the original data server 1, where the request includes plaintext id information and id type. The plaintext identification information may be one item or multiple items. If the identification information contains a plurality of items of identification information, each item of identification information contains information for identifying the identity type.
F202, after the identification encryption and decryption server 2 receives the request for obtaining the encrypted identification sent by the original data server 1, the identification type is identified; f203 is then executed to determine and record whether the unique identification information is contained therein.
If the unique identification is included and the request includes other non-unique identification information, F204 is executed, the identification encryption and decryption server 2 associates, according to the non-unique identification information in the request information, each identification information that does not include the unique identification information in the information table to be updated in the identification encryption and decryption server 2, generates new user identification association information according to the association result, and then F205 is executed. If the request does not contain a unique identity, F205 is performed directly.
F205, the identity encryption and decryption server 2 determines, according to the obtained plaintext identity information and the identity type, whether the existing plaintext identity information base of the identity encryption and decryption server 2 contains the plaintext identity information, if the plaintext identity information in the request is inconsistent with the existing identity information of the identity encryption and decryption server 2, if the request does not contain the unique identity, the identity information is not updated, and if the request contains the unique identity, the encrypted identity information is returned, as shown in F206;
if the identity contained in the request does not exist in the existing plaintext identity information base of the identity encryption and decryption server 2, the plaintext identity is added to the user information table of the identity encryption and decryption server 2. For the information table which does not contain the unique identity, the information table is placed into an information table to be updated; the one with the unique id is put into the user id information table and the encrypted id is returned, as shown in F207.
In one embodiment of the big data accurate marketing system with privacy protection, the original data server 1 communicates with the big data processing server 3, and the original data server 1 replaces user identification marks in various kinds of original data with encrypted identification mark information and then sends the encrypted identification mark information to the big data processing server 3;
the data screened by the target user by the big data tag server 4 is provided by the big data processing server 3, the data analyzed and processed by the big data processing server 3 is at least the information of the user access site, the attribute of the access site, the access frequency and the stay time of the big data processing server 3 are analyzed and then the user is marked with a corresponding tag, the marked user data is sent to the big data tag server 4, and the data transmitted by the big data processing server 3 to the big data tag server 4 comprises the unique identification of the user: encrypted identification information;
the tags are divided into basic tags and interest tags; the base tag includes: age, gender, place of employment, place of residence, school calendar; the interest tag includes: the system comprises a first-level label, a second-level label and a third-level label, wherein the first-level label is a classification with large user interest, and the second-level label is a subclass of the first-level label; the third-level label is a detailed label corresponding to the website name.
The big data processing server 3 pushes the result information after the analysis is completed to the big data label server 4. The big data label server 4 takes the encrypted identity as the unique identity of the user, and stores the label information corresponding to the user. When receiving the data sent by the big data processing server 3, judging whether the user label information already exists in the user table, if so, updating the user information, and if not, adding the user label information to the user table of the big data label server 4. The data of the big data label server 4 is inquired according to the business requirement of the marketing management server 5.
In an embodiment of the big data accurate marketing system with privacy protection, the user demand collection client 7 provides a marketing demand input interface for a user, and sends demand data submitted by the user to the user demand management server 8, where the data submitted by the user at least includes:
target user attribute information of the marketing requirement, wherein the target user attribute information comprises a basic tag attribute, a position tag attribute and an interest tag attribute, and the basic tag attribute comprises: age, gender, education, consumption level, cell phone type and model.
The release time of the marketing requirement;
the marketing content;
the marketing management server 5 receives and manages marketing requirements sent by the user requirement management server 8, and submits data extraction requirements to the big data tag server 4 according to the release tasks;
the submitting of the data extraction requirement by the marketing management server 5 to the big data tag server 4 comprises:
the unique identification of the marketing requirement is the task ID;
target user attribute information of the marketing requirement, wherein the target user attribute information comprises a basic tag attribute, a user position attribute and an interest tag attribute; the basic tag attributes include: age, gender, education, consumption level, cell phone type and model;
the data returned by the big data tag server 4 to the marketing management server 5 includes:
the unique identification of the marketing requirement is the task ID;
according to the marketing requirement, the user screens the encrypted target user identity information screened out by the label;
and screening the number of target users screened out by the labels according to the marketing requirement.
The business requirements are generated by the user requirement acquisition client 7, and users with accurate marketing requirements set the number of target users for releasing tasks, the task releasing time and the releasing area through a marketing requirement input interface provided by the user requirement acquisition client 7, and set labels for screening the target users. The target user screening label comprises a basic label and an interest label. The delivery area corresponds to the work place, the residence or the daily activity range of the target user. After setting a delivery task at the user demand collection client 7, the user submits the delivery task data to the user demand management server 8.
In an embodiment of the big data accurate marketing system with privacy protection, the marketing management server 5 communicates with the marketing delivery server 6, the marketing management server 5 sends delivery information to the marketing delivery server 6 after obtaining the user data returned by the big data tag server 4, and the data transmitted by the marketing management server 5 and the marketing delivery server 6 at least includes:
the unique identification of the marketing task, namely the task ID;
encrypting the identity identification information by the target user of the marketing;
the content of the marketing;
the starting time and the ending time of the marketing;
after completing the delivery task, the marketing management server 5 sends the delivery result to the marketing management server 5, and the sent data at least includes:
the unique identification of the marketing task, namely the task ID;
the number of users who are successfully released in the marketing task;
and the target user who is successfully released in the marketing task encrypts the identity identification and the successful releasing time.
In an embodiment of the big data accurate marketing system with privacy protection, the marketing delivery server 6 communicates with the id encryption and decryption server 2, the marketing delivery server 6 sends a request for obtaining the id information of the plaintext user to the id encryption and decryption server 2, and the sent request at least includes:
encrypting user identification information;
encrypting the user identity type;
the plaintext identity type of the request;
the identity encryption and decryption server 2 feeds back the decrypted user identity information to the marketing delivery server 6 after receiving the user identity decryption request, and the returned user identity information at least comprises:
encrypting user identification information;
encrypting the user identity type;
a plaintext identity type;
plaintext identification information;
when the marketing hair server sends a decryption request to the identity encryption and decryption server 2, the carried information comprises: an encrypted identification type, encrypted identification information, and a requested identification type. The identification mark encryption and decryption server 2 identifies the type to which the encrypted identification mark information belongs according to the encrypted identification mark type mark. The identity encryption and decryption server 2 determines which type of plaintext identity is returned according to the type of the requested identity. That is, the encrypted id type carried in the request message and the requested id information may not be consistent. If the resident identification card information is carried, the mobile phone number can be requested to be returned. If the identity information of the request does not exist in the identity encryption and decryption server 2, the returned information does not exist.
Please refer to fig. 3. Fig. 3 is a schematic flow chart of the communication between the id encryption/decryption server 2 and the marketing delivery server 6 in the example of the present application. The id encryption/decryption server 2 receives the request for obtaining the plaintext id information sent by the marketing delivery server 6, as in F301. The request contains encrypted identification information, an encrypted identity type and a plaintext identity type to be obtained. The identity identification encryption and decryption server 2 judges the encryption identity type requested to be sent and the plaintext identity information type to be acquired according to the received information; as shown at F302. The id encryption/decryption server 2 searches for a field corresponding to the user id information table according to the type of the received encrypted id information, and determines whether the encrypted user id information in the request is included, as shown in F303. If the encrypted user identification information in the request is found, next, whether the requested plaintext identification type is contained in the user identification information is judged, as shown in F304, and if the requested plaintext identification type exists, the plaintext identification information specified by the user is returned, as shown in F305. If the user identification information that is consistent with the encrypted identification information in the request is not found, or the user that is consistent with the encrypted identification information in the request is found but the user identification information does not contain the requested plaintext identification information, a failure message is returned, as in F306.
Marketing input server 6 pushes or demonstrates marketing information to the user, marketing input server 6 includes to the mode of user propelling movement information: short message, multimedia message, WAP, client or WEB. The marketing content includes different types of data for different channel types. The short message channel mode can only contain text content, and the multimedia message channel mode, the mail channel mode or the page mode can comprise characters, voice, pictures or video.
